It's a New Year

I am really excited and anxious to resume my BJJ training. In the past few months, I have really been focusing on trying to stay in shape, cardio-wise, and increase my upper body strength. I plan to go to class this coming Tuesday night and hit the mats. I have also been reviewing a lot of videos on Youtube and other sites, including Submissions 101 and TrainFightWin.

I have an extremely supportive wife and she got me Saulo Ribeiro's JIU-JITSU UNIVERSITY (which is just an excellent textbook on the art), BJ Penn's book on the closed guard, and the three DVD set by Renzo Gracie (which so far is also quite good).

I ran across an interesting saying in one of the message forums recently. A guy said he doesn't fear a man who knows 1,000 submissons 1 way, he fears a man who knows 1 submission 1,000 ways. I think this is going to be the approach I am going to adopt this time around. I want to focus on a single technique for awhile until I perfect it and can do it in my sleep.

It's gonna be a good year, I think.
